Artist History
Emerged in New York no-wave, played New York and Europe, released first record; hibernated for a decade, re-emerging in mid-nineties NY, released new record. |
 |
Group Members
David Rosenbloom, guitar; David Hofstra, bass;John Mernit/Steve Moses,drums. |
